Just want to offer this up here since I haven't seen it listed exactly. Very good basic mech here, if a little short ranged. 40 point alpha, good mobility at 72.6 tweaked with jumpjets and excellent cooling. Very tough with standard engine, full armor (-1 each leg), and AMS included as well. I'm comfy with 15 on the backplates, but tweak to your liking there. There are higher alpha/higher ranged builds out there for sure, but not at this level of mobility and toughness. Nothin real flashy - just a good well-rounded rig, minus the range limitation. So, from that standpoint, obviously more suited to those that prefer to be up close and personal and that have solid ballistic skills. You have 28 shots of AC/20 to bash someones face in with, so the single biggest sin in anything packing the Big Kahuna like this is to miss. If you can do the driving part well enough to get yourself into good firing envelopes and get your rounds onto your target then most of the time you're gonna have a pretty good game. Came to the same build on my own as well, it's been shining all day in my new 3D. The JJs really help your AC20 overcome the low slung ballistic hardpoint and less than amazing maneuverability. The combination of jump jets, STD engine, and torso twisting while your weapons are all cooling down will add significant survivability over other less maneuverable, XL 'phracts.
